AMD Ryzen 5 3600 is a six-core processor with a maximum boost clock speed of 4.2 GHz. It features 32MB of L3 cache and supports Socket AM4 motherboards. It runs at 3.6 GHz by default, but it can boost to 4.2 GHz depending on workload. This processor features 3,800 million transistors and a 7nm production node.
